The Concept XTS 34 is the shortest and lightest of the three Concept XTS bows, made for archers who would rather have a lively bow than an especially steady one.
34 inches axle to axle and a 6.25 inch brace height make it the most responsive model in the range. It reacts more directly, it is easier to handle indoors and on a course, and at 4.75 pounds it weighs noticeably less than its bigger siblings. The shorter brace height gives the arrow a longer power stroke, but it also forgives small errors in execution a little less than a tall one does.
Behind it sits the SCTR 2.0 cam system, Hoyt's reworked cam generation. It runs more smoothly at the front and the end of the draw force curve than its predecessor while adding around four feet per second.
Draw length is set by the module. The CDM covers 24.5 to 27.5 inches and the TDM picks up above it, from 27.5 to 29.5 inches. Both are rotating modules that step through their positions in half inch increments, so changing within the range needs no new part. The difference is in the feel: the TDM draws noticeably softer at its top position, which is why Hoyt recommends it for archers at the long end.
There is also the modular grip system with six grip plates at 0, plus 4 and plus 8 degrees, each of them also available in a version that shortens draw length by an eighth of an inch. Hand position can be adjusted without touching the tune of the bow.

Specifications
- Axle to axle: 34 inches
- Brace height: 6.25 inches
- Speed: 334 fps
- Mass weight: 4.75 lbs
- Cam system: SCTR 2.0
- Draw length with CDM: 24.5 to 27.5 inches
- Draw length with TDM: 27.5 to 29.5 inches
- Draw weights: 40, 50, 55, 60, 65 and 70 lbs
- Grip plates: 0, plus 4 and plus 8 degrees, each also with minus 1/8 inch
